Abstract

Garcinia mangostana Linn. or mangosteen through various parts of the plant and its contents are widely used as an alternative medicine for various diseases by assessing their pharmacological effects, including antidiabetec, antihyperlipidemia, antiobesity, antioxidants, analgesic, anti-inflammatory, anticancer, antidepressant, antibacterial, renoprotective, and neuroprotective. This material is easy to find and even found in Indonesia, Malay, Myanmar, Thailand, Cambodia, and Vietnam, and even has been cultivated in tropical regions such as India, Honduras, Brazil, and Australia. Research on Mangosteen continues to grow, both in vivo, in vitro, and in silico from year to year until now, this can be seen from various publications conducted by researchers. This can be a reference to make mangosteen as alternative medicine that can be widely used by the community, especially in terms of pharmacological effects.
